We recently had lunch at Lympstone Manor when they were offering a special lunchtime deal. This place is beautiful, the setting is idyllic and we were very well looked after on arrival. After some drinks and canapés, we were taken to our table and shortly given our appetiser. Then nothing happened for 45 minutes, we watched tables around us being served ahead of us, and were confused what was happening. Because it’s such a posh restaurant and there was so many staff, we figured they must know that we were waiting so we left it longer than usual to point out that we hadn’t even had starters. By the time they arrived we had been sat there for an hour and after a 90 minute drive to the restaurant we were starting to run out of things to talk about, and were generally feeling awkward about the delay. We’d also eaten two bread rolls eat because we had been waiting so long and we’re very hungry which then really took the edge of our appetite for the main event. The food was all very nice and the rest of it came in a timely manner afterwe’d complained. The waiter did remove our soft drinks from the bill, (approximately £10) and offered to remove the service charge, but we declined that offer. I wouldn’t have written a negative review if it was just this instance, but the time before that, when we visited in April 2024, we were saying in one of the shepherds huts, and went for dinner at the new poolside restaurant. Again, we waited a fair amount of time for our starters, and when our main courses came, they were wrong so had to be sent back. When they returned with our food, our steak was half the size of the original overcooked one, the chips still had truffle on, which we’d asked to not be added, and our mushroom is missing. We ate this meal though. as it was getting late. In the end they didn’t charge us for a meal, but it was our anniversary and we had gone and stayed there as a special treat & especially to enjoy delicious food, and so had been left very disappointed and unsatisfied. I was expecting them to invite us back for dinner at a reduced rate or a complimentary meal, but they didn’t. And then again visiting this week I was left disappointed by what is a Michelin star restaurant. Maybe we have just been unlucky.

Property Description

  • Number of Rooms: 21
With a stay at Lympstone Manor Hotel in Exmouth, you'll be near the beach, just a 5-minute walk from Exmouth Beach and a 4-minute drive from Dorset and East Devon Coast. This golf hotel is 3.5 mi (5.7 km) from Devon Cliffs Beach and 9.4 mi (15.2 km) from Crealy Great Adventure Park.

Take advantage of recreation opportunities such as a seasonal outdoor pool or take in the view from a terrace and a garden. This hotel also features complimentary wireless internet access, concierge services, and babysitting (surcharge).

Satisfy your appetite for lunch or dinner at the hotel's restaurant, or stay in and take advantage of the 24-hour room service. Relax with your favorite drink at the bar/lounge or the poolside bar. A complimentary continental breakfast is served daily from 7:30 AM to 10:00 AM.

Featured amenities include complimentary newspapers in the lobby, dry cleaning/laundry services, and a 24-hour front desk. Free valet parking is available onsite.

Make yourself at home in one of the 21 individually decorated guestrooms, featuring espresso makers and flat-screen televisions. Complimentary wireless internet access keeps you connected, and satellite programming is available for your entertainment. Private bathrooms have rainfall showerheads and designer toiletries. Conveniences include safes and complimentary newspapers, as well as phones with free local calls.
